Timeless Devotion Rekindled: Exploring the Emotional Depth of The Statler Brothers – (I’ll Even Love You) Better Than I Did Then
In the golden tradition of country harmony, The Statler Brothers – (I’ll Even Love You) Better Than I Did Then stands as a tender reminder of love’s evolution over time. Known for their masterful storytelling and four-part harmonies that feel like home, The Statler Brothers bring both sincerity and depth to this heartfelt ballad—offering not just a song, but a poignant reflection on love matured, tested, and deepened through life’s seasons.
Originally released during the group’s later years, this track is a testament to the enduring relevance of their music. While many love songs focus on new romance and passion in bloom, The Statler Brothers – (I’ll Even Love You) Better Than I Did Then takes a more thoughtful, seasoned approach. It’s a message that resonates especially with listeners who have walked a few miles in love’s shoes—those who understand that real devotion often reveals itself not in the early days, but in the quiet, steady perseverance over time.
The lyrics speak of a love that has grown wiser, gentler, and more intentional. “I’ll even love you better than I did then” is not merely a romantic phrase—it’s a profound acknowledgment of the lessons learned through shared joys and sorrows. The song doesn’t idealize the past but elevates the present, suggesting that the deepest kind of love comes after life has taught us how to truly give it.
Musically, the track showcases The Statler Brothers at their finest—rich harmonies, a softly rolling melody, and arrangements that leave plenty of room for the message to breathe. It’s understated yet moving, personal yet universally relatable.
